## Account Recovery — Trailnote Offline Mode

When a surveyor's Trailnote app has been offline for 30+ days, their local credentials expire and sync refuses to resume. Don't make them wipe the device — all their unsynced field data lives there! Instead, open the support console, pick "Offline Reinstate," and enter their handle. The console will ask for the support team's shared recovery passphrase before issuing a reinstatement token. Use the one below.

unlock words, bagaf-fajeg: zorael-kelax-fraath-quenix-eliok-sileth-aldmir-wenir-druiel

TURN-208: Gatevale turnstile counters at the Merrow Field pilot double-count when a rotation reverses mid-cycle. Attendance totals drift roughly 2% high per event. The debounce window fix is implemented, reviewed by Ilsa, and soak-tested across two simulated match days without drift. Ready for your cut; the candidate build is identified below.

trace token, tagag-tafog: htk6_5ed18c

**Vendor note: Inkmill markdown pipeline**

Rendering for Parchway docs is outsourced to Inkmill under an annual contract, renewing each March. They handle sanitization and PDF export; we own the upload queue. SLA: 4-hour response on rendering failures. Escalate only after two failed retries. Their support desk is reachable at the address below.

billing contact of hahaf-baguf = zorael.tammir.jorius@sivrelhq.internal

**14:22** — Payroll export job on Ledgerline began emitting the new column-delimited format ahead of schedule. The downstream Fairmont importer, still expecting fixed-width records, silently truncated overtime fields for roughly 300 employees. On-call was paged at 14:31 after reconciliation checksums failed. Rollback to the previous exporter build completed at 14:47; affected files were regenerated and re-sent by 15:10. The importer now rejects unrecognized formats outright. The exact build involved is recorded below for reference.

trace token, fafog-kageg: htk4_98e6